Job Description

Service Engineer Start: ASAP Length: 18 monthsLocation: Remote Rate: £388PD PAYE (eq. to £450PD Umbrella)Engagement: Inside IR35 - PAYE via Trust in Soda Trust in Soda are partnered with an award winning video game studio owned by one of the biggest tech companies globally. The Services team is responsible for the development and operations of the clients websites and services that support their games.At this exciting time in the Studios history, they are seeking a talented C# developer with a wide range of skills to work both internally and alongside external partners on projects that are complementary to our games.They are big believers in high-quality engineering, and since theyre developing products as services, the aim for fast iteration but with a focus on robust methods. This means embracing modern development practices such as continuous delivery, automatedtesting, code reviews, pair programming and agile methods. So expect to bring your teamwork and communication skills as your knowledge and experience can be brought to bear in these areas as well as during meetings and standups.Key Accountabilities

  • Deliver high-fidelity web-based solutions to support their next games.
  • Build creative solutions to technical problems encountered.
  • Continuously work to minimise technical debt and maintenance hazards.
  • Champion quality in our development process, demonstrating our values and taking an active role in improvement of engineering
Required Skills and Experience
  • Experience with C#. We use a mixture of net 6 and 4.7.
  • Experience in modern JavaScript web development, especially with ReactJS
  • Experience with Azure DevOps, or other automated build systems.
  • Experience with Automated Testing
  • Be enthusiastic about modern development techniques and be demonstrably keen to apply them.
  • Show us that you have rock solid software design, programming and testing skills
  • Strong teamwork and communication skills as the role rarely requires working in isolation
